Output 177d670793261e24a742beed2ac4600c650fcb2349435241e9ea0031dd189237:2

value
149590295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6667bd197bc48fe06f88b6c0d5ff8750d1413f60 OP_EQUAL
address
MHEdRtLw2EAJ3qiAkNthMFr8KikqmxXx9C
transaction
177d670793261e24a742beed2ac4600c650fcb2349435241e9ea0031dd189237
spent
true